Credit: Costa del MarA popular choice among fishing and water sport enthusiasts, Costa Del Mar offers a full range of polarized sunglasses, said Tauaefa. Pick between glass and polycarbonate polarization, which helps make objects crisper and brighter even in harsh sun. "It feels like you can see through the ocean. [It] makes the color more transparent and beautiful," said Media & Tech Reviews Analyst Olivia Lipski. Though, these lack nose pad grips, meaning they can slide down when sweating.
Size: 135mm frame width in total | UV Protection: Yes | Polarized: Yes

Best Aviator Sunglasses
Randolph USA 23K Gold Classic Aviator Sunglasses
Credit: Randolph USA
Priding themselves on a curated lineup of hand-crafted frames, Randolph, the family-owned business, has been a prime aviator supplier for the US military since the '80s. Their unique bayonet temple tips were designed for comfort under headgear — though many pairs also come in standard arm iterations. Timeless styles like the Classic Aviator are outfitted in silver, gold and matte black hardware. Considering the craftsmanship and use of real gold, these are a worthy spend.
Size: 55mm frame width | UV Protection: Yes | Polarized: No, but options available

Best Sunglasses for Running
Oakley OO9191 Unstoppable Rectangular Sunglasses
Credit: Oakley
The official sunglass brand of the NFL, Oakley is a leading eyewear brand in sports. Brown-tinted lenses like these enhance contrast and depth perception, making them ideal for outdoor activities like fishing or golfing, Tauaefa said. One reviewer who runs marathons appreciates that these have wrap-around coverage and don't steam up. Another added that they don't slip while running and hiking. Pro tip: You might want to buy a hard case to store these since they only come with a soft sleeve.
Size: 65mm lens width | UV Protection: Yes | Polarized: Yes
